I started reading the book: Beginning Game Audio Programming by Mason McCuskey (2003). A fact that I didn't know about: the 74-minute length of the first audio CDs was specifically designed to fit Beethoven's Ninth Symphony. A composer who died several hundred years ago had such a great influence on the formation of one of the most ubiquitous parts of audio technology.
